청렴

Korean

Etymology

Sino-Korean word from (clear, clean) + (honest, pure).

Pronunciation

Romanizations
Revised Romanization?cheongnyeom
Revised Romanization (translit.)?cheonglyeom
McCune–Reischauer?ch'ŏngnyŏm
Yale Romanization?chenglyem

Noun

청렴 (cheongnyeom) (hanja 淸廉)

  1. honesty, uncorruptedness, integrity
